How to fix?

Upgrade org.springframework.ai:spring-ai-vector-store to version 1.0.5, 1.1.4 or higher.

Overview

Affected versions of this package are vulnerable to Arbitrary Code Injection in the SimpleVectorStore function when unescaped user-supplied input is used as a filter expression key. An attacker can execute arbitrary code by supplying crafted input that is evaluated by the expression engine.

Note:

This is only exploitable if the application uses SimpleVectorStore and passes user-supplied input as a filter expression key.
